Meet The World’s Largest Tractor: The Legendary Big Bud
By DANNY BOJIC
Built in 1977 in Havre, Montana, Big Bud is a 747 farm tractor standing 14 feet tall and 27 feet long. It weighs over 100,000 pounds and has a 1,100 horsepower engine.
Throughout the 1980s and 90s, Big Bud was a top-of-the-line deep ripper, breaking up soil at depths ordinary plows couldn’t reach. After years of work, Big Bud was retired in 2009.
However, that’s not the end for Big Bud. While Big Bud’s deep-ripping days may be over, the iconic line of tractors came back in 2023, though at a smaller size.
According to Western Ag Network, the new Big Buds weigh 70,000 pounds and have 640-750 horsepower. They are designed to be a go-to for any farmer needing an oversized vehicle.
